EXAMENS fin formation Comptable D'entreprises

EXAMENS fin formation  Comptable D'entreprises



 fin formation TCE .









Information



Le code PHP dans chacune des pages HTML agit à chaque chargement et rafraîchissement de
la page web. L’ensemble de mes scripts PHP que j’ai réalisé possède tous la même structure.
Tout d’abord je me connecte à ma base MySQL, ensuite je crée et exécute ma requête et
pour finir j’affiche le résultat.
Le serveur de base de données MySQL est très souvent utilisé avec le langage de création de
pages web dynamiques qui est PHP.
J’ai implémenté des fonctions JavaScripts notamment pour dynamiser les formulaires et de
réaliser un traitement correct lors des envois des formulaires.
Ensuite, voici la liste des outils que j’ai utilisés pour la réalisation du site web transactionnel :
- WampServer
WampServer est très complet puisqu’il dispose du serveur Apache2, gère des fichiers du
langage de scripts PHP et d’une base de données MySQL. Il possède également
PHPMyAdmin qui permet de gérer les bases de données.
J’ai utilisé WampServer puisque c’est une plate-forme de développement Web
sous Windows pour des applications Web dynamiques. Il m’a permis donc de
pouvoir concevoir le site web transactionnel en local sur mon ordinateur.
Le langage PHP est un langage de programmation web exécuté côté serveur et non
du côté client comme le langage JavaScript. J'ai réalisé des scripts PHP pour rendre
le site web dynamique et de pouvoir modifier le contenu du site web.
MySQL dérive directement de SQL (Structured Query Language) qui est un
langage de requête vers les bases de données exploitant le modèle
relationnel, mais ne possède pas toute la puissance du langage SQL.
JavaScript est un langage interprété par le navigateur. Le JavaScript est
un langage « client », c'est-à-dire exécuté chez l'utilisateur lorsque la
page Web est chargée. Il a pour but de dynamiser les sites Internet.
Maxime CAPOLINO – IUT Lille A – Département Informatique – 2011/2012 14
- Adobe Dreamweaver
Si un simple éditeur de texte, comme Notepad ou Bloc-notes fait très bien l’affaire. J’ai tout
de même choisi d’utiliser Adobe Dreamweaver.
Tout d’abord pour son auto complétion HTML et CSS qui est très pratique, agréable et
rapide. Ainsi que par les différents modes de conception offerts, la transition entre les
différents modes de conception est très rapide ce que je trouve très agréable lors du
commencement de la structure du site web. Il me permet de voir instantanément si mes
éléments graphiques ont été correctement appelés, structurés et positionnés.
- FileZilla
FTP signifie File Transfert Protocol ou Protocole de Transfert de Fichiers. C'est un protocole
de communication qui permet l'échange de fichiers sur internet avec un réseau TCP/IP.
Le FTP fonctionne selon le modèle client-serveur. C’est-à-dire, un client depuis lequel on
envoie les fichiers et un serveur FTP, sur lequel on envoie les fichiers. Un client FTP est donc
un logiciel qui permet de faire la liaison entre le client et le serveur.
Pour des raisons de sécurité, FileZilla propose un mode dans lequel il ne conserve aucune
trace des mots de passe sur l’ordinateur. Ainsi, une authentification est nécessaire à chaque
connexion aux serveurs
- Adobe Flash Professional
En effet, je l’ai utilisé pour effectuer des animations de bases en ActionScript 3 pour la page
d’introduction du site web que je vais vous présenter ultérieurement dans ce rapport.
Pour la réalisation des pages web du site, j’ai utilisé le logiciel Adobe
Dreamweaver qui est un logiciel de création de sites web.
Concernant l’envoi de l’ensemble de mes fichiers vers l’hébergeur web, j’ai
transféré mes fichiers avec le client FTP de FileZilla.
En plus d’Adobe Dreamweaver, j’ai utilisé un autre logiciel de la suite
d’Adobe qui est Adobe Flash Professional. C’est un puissant logiciel
d’environnement de création d'animations et de contenus multimédias. Il
permet de concevoir des animations avec un système de calques et de
timeline.
Maxime CAPOLINO – IUT Lille A – Département Informatique – 2011/2012 15
Pour finir, voici le logiciel avec lequel j’ai réalisé le canevas du journal.
- Microsoft Publisher
II) Réalisation du site web
1) Analyse et mise en situation
a) Première prise de contact
La première rencontre avec mes employeurs a permis d’identifier le besoin du SCFP 4475
concernant le site web transactionnel.
Le SCFP 4475 a un problème dans la communication et la transmission d’informations avec
leurs membres. En effet, le SCFP 4475 ne possède pas les outils nécessaires pour réaliser une
communication optimale avec ses membres.
Actuellement, le SCFP utilise un intranet « Lotus Notes » fourni par l’employeur pour
permettre la communication entre le syndicat et l’employeur et la partage d’informations.
Le SCFP 4475 transmet les différentes informations par l’intermédiaire d’un panneau
d’affichage dans chaque site, ainsi que par l’édition d’un journal tous les 3 mois. En cas de
renseignements, les membres du SCFP 4474 doivent contacter les membres de l’exécutif soit
en allant les rencontrer aux bureaux ou soit par communication téléphonique. Tous ces
éléments rendent une communication entre le syndicat et les membres assez difficile.
C’est pour cela que le SCFP 4475 souhaite posséder un site web personnel pour permettre
de transmettre les informations aux membres très rapidement et de rendre très accessible
les divers documents en ligne.
Néanmoins, les membres de l’exécutif du SCFP 4475 n’ayant pas de connaissances en
informatique ni de mon niveau dans le développement web. Ils ne savaient pas ce qu’ils
pouvaient obtenir comme site web.




Commentaires